VHS Give Aways

Technology is improving at almost exponential speed.  It really wasn't that long ago we had books in our library on audio cassette tapes.


Within the last ten years, we deleted those from our collection because they were rarely checked out.  People preferred books on CD rather than audio cassette.




Now it appears another of our friends may soon be leaving us.  We browsed our VHS shelves the other day and were very surprised to find the majority of the tapes had not been circulated in the last two years!  That meant it was time to "weed" and we pulled a LOT of them.  The good news for you is we are giving them away for free but we don't know how long they will last.  You can find them while we have them on the back of the return cart by the circulation desk.



Any new videos we purchase will be DVD format.  An advantage to those is they are thinner so we gained some shelf space.
